Summary: During Red Ribbon Week, schools and many community agencies throughout California will join together to highlight their commitment of a drug and tobacco free society. Through this proclamation, the Mt. Diablo Unified School District Board of Education urges all students, staff, parents, and members of our community to wear a red ribbon during the week of October 23, 2019 to October 31, 2019. Red Ribbon Week and to support efforts to make our schools and community drug and tobacco free.
